Method 1, the Water Burnish. Tools that are required are sandpaper, edge beveller, water, a sponge and edge slicker. First dampen the edge of your leather with a water soaked sponge and begin sanding the edge lightly until you get rid of the the frayed edge fibres.

Nettet7. jul. 2024 · WHAT IS BURNISHED LEATHER? Burnishing is a finishing technique where the leather is smoothed, by applying pressure and friction, and is given a darker, more antiqued colour. Leather is often burnished on the edges using a metal tool, such as a spinning disk. What is hand burnished leather? NettetA leather burnisher, also referred to as a leather slicker, is a tool usually made from wood. They, via the heat generated from friction, help to smoothen and harden the edges of leather goods.
